ACH

ACH (automated clearing house) is the name given to a type of transfer between banks. This is one of the live casino payments methods now offered, and you may also see ACH e-checks offered as a fast, secure way of moving cash.

Disadvantages of Using ACH

This method is one of the slowest ways of withdrawing money from online live casinos. Cashing out can take several days.

How to Deposit 

Choose the ACH or e-check option from the live casino payment methods listed. You will then be prompted to enter your bank details and the amount you want to transfer in. This lets you start playing with real cash and claim any welcome bonuses on offer.

How to Cash Out

Look for this as an available withdrawal method. It will bring up the bank details that you already entered, so you simply need to check if everything is in order before proceeding.

Fees and Charges with ACH

Your casino won’t make any charges for your ACH deposits and withdrawals. You’ll need to check with your bank to see if the same applies to them.
